ALBANY, Ga. — The Gamma Omicron Lambda and Delta Delta Chapters of Alpha Phi Alpha Fraternity, Inc., at Albany State College observed their Annual Education Campaign with a series of programs during the week. The campaign got off to a good start Sunday, April 25, with Dr. Aaron Brown, president, Albany State College and Gamma Omicron Lambda chapter giving the principal address.

In keeping with its theme "Education A Beacon Light in a Confused World" this national officer, Dr. Brown pointed out our national historic interest in education emphasized some of the best current aims of education, presented some present day evidences of educational inequalities, and suggested the individual's responsibility in making education a stronger beacon in our confused world.

Citing the recognition our forefathers made in respect to Education. Dr. Brown quoted from George Washington's farewell address "promote then, as an object of primary importance, institutions for the general diffusion of knowledge." The first Massachusetts constitution stated wisdom and knowledge, as well as virtue, diffused generally among the body of the people and as this depends on spreading the opportunities and advantages of education in the various parts of the country, and among different orders of the people it shall be the duty, to cherish the interests of literature and the sciences. In discourse he cited Statistical Data Showing Educational Differences Through The States and Interpreted It To Mean That Where Little Is Done For Education, Slow Progress Has Been Made. If America is to play its role in a confused world we must eliminate the differences the speaker asserted.
